| Part II of Run Summary for 940519 (Bob Granetz will write up part I, containing most of the good news) SL: Wolfe PO: Marmar EO: Daigle Miniproposal 41 - Restart C-MOD Granetz turned over the run to me at around 13:30, after shot 8. Things had been going well, about six good shots in a row; somehow he managed to sabotage things before I even sat down. Shot 9, which had already been set up and differed from shot 8 only by changes after 0.6 sec, fizzled. Following this inauspicious beginning, we floundered for a few shots, some of which were actually duds, the first of theday. Shot 14 ran until 530msec, then was lost down. This shot, like earlier shots, was programmed to be at ZCUR=0.0, but in fact bothe xrays and EFIT claimed it was at -2cm. The Hybrid Aout claimed it was centered. Apparently, there was a problem with the ZCUR predictor. Ignoring the ZCUR problem for the moment, since we couldn't find any bad magnetics by inspection, we tried getting rid of some of the IC controllers which were fighting the shape controllers. Specifically, we turned off the gain on IC_EF1L and IC_EF2L after .2sec, when ZXL and RXL turned on. RXL was running inside and did not appear well-controlled. The next several shots were failures of one flavor or another. For shot 21 I decided to bite the bullet and work on the null. I made the EF1 currents 300 amps more positive to try to reverse the Bz gradient and provide a stable index during the current rise. Amazingly, this worked, and shot 21 ran through 700msec. The null was only there briefly, because we did not compensate for the Bz increase, but it broke down and the current rise was good. On shot 22, we attempted to compensate the Bz, but may have overdone it; the shot fizzled. Shot 23 was a reload of shot 21, and ran well until 530msec. Both shots 21 and 23 had the same ZCUR problem as shot 14, namely the hybrid thought they were centered when the xrays and EFIT thought they were low by at least 2cm. After the run, the problem with ZCUR predictor on the later shots was investigated. It turns out that BP17_DE went bad sometime between shots 8 and 14, possibly right at the end of shot 8. This failure is insidious, in that on shot 14 at least the signal comes back to zero at the end of the shot, but is wrong (relative to BP17_JK, aka the processed flux) by up to .15 Tesla during flattop. This was found by direct comparison of all of the BP inputs to the hybrid, with BTOR_PICKUP*\BTOR subtracted, to the corresponding JK loops. Since BP17_DE was installed last year as a replacement for BP17_BC, it will be necessary to replace it with the JK loop (or the GH, provided we reconnect it to CAMAC). Essentially no progress on the miniproposal was made during the second half of the run, although turning off the superfluous IC_EF1L and IC_EF2L controls is logically a good thing, and seemed to do no harm. The null with the EF1's more positive is a step in the direction of more stable breakdowns and current rises, I believe, but it needs some additional tweaking up. The Bz is presently too positive, and the index may actually be a bit too positive during the early rise phase. The plasma is still fat and riding the inner limiter until after 0.5 sec. CLEARIN does not seem to be working correctly when turned on early. RXL is too far inside and did not seem well controlled. ZXL is close to where it is being commanded, which is somewhat too high for good matching to the divertor. The elongations get quite high with the plasma centered if we allow the xpoint height to be correct. It may be that xpoint control will improve when BP17 is replaced with a working signal, but the RXL control didn't seem to be working earlier in the run either. |

| Part I of Run Summary for 940519 SL: Granetz/Wolfe PO: Marmar EO: Daigle Miniproposal 41 - Restart C-MOD The first half of this run was more successful than prior runs this week. We had 8 shots, 6 of which had plasma currents of more than 0.8 MA. Most of these lasted to at least 0.7 s, with one actually getting part way down the current rampdown before disrupting. There sometimes is a position control problem early in the plasma formation (25-50 ms). It kills the proto-plasma on shots which have a relatively slower current rise. So far the only way around this is to have a clean enough machine so that dIp/dt is not slowed down. Obviously not very satisfactory. There was a problem with blown SCR's and a failed gate-driver board in EF2L, which was discovered after the first couple of shots, but which probably had been bad since April. The first two plasmas that we got both disrupted due to excessive elongation. This probably was caused by CLEARIN feedback on the OH2's, and is not understood. By delaying CLEARIN feedback until after 0.6 s, we managed to get longer shots. The best shots (6,7,8) were diverted after 0.5 s and were centered on the midplane, which is required for matching to the antennas. The programmed position of the x-point was pushed outward in major radius on successive shots, and this seems to be working, for the most part, although RXL is still not as far out as we'd like. During the second half of the run, it was discovered that 2 Bp coils became flaky. These both are connected at D-bottom port, which is the other flange that was re-installed during my absence last March. It is very likely that those connectors were also not properly screwed on, just like at B-bottom. |

| May 19 1994 06:26:39:980PM | Steve Wolfe | We have another bad bp-coil hooked to the hybrid, and this time it's a DE loop.
BP17_DE went bad sometime during the run today. Furthermore, you can't tell from looking at the reset; it is bad during the shot and comes back to zero. I found it by direct comparison with BP17_JK, after subtracting the BTOR_PICKUPs from each. On shot 14, which ended up 2cm low despite the fact that ZCUR said it was centered, the BP17_DE (corrected by BTOR_PICKUP) goes to -.6T during flattop, while BP17_JK (similarly corrected, identical to processed BP_16) goes to -.75, a discrepancy of 0.15 Tesla. On this shot both signals come back to zero, within 10mT. On shot 8, which actually was centered, the two signals overlay perfectly during the shot, both getting to about -.75T, but the DE loop has about a .1Tesla offset at the end of the shot. We (Bob) need to fix this before tomorrow's run. I suppose we'll have to use the JK loop, unless we want to reconnect the GH loop to CAMAC. Note that BP17_xx is on the outer shelf, right next to the crandulated flux loop. Maybe there's a connection, maybe not, but we clearly need this coil to help make up for the lack of F17. We are still losing magnetics at an alarming rate. This one is presumably on a different port, and may not be related to connector problems at all, but it could be.
